@import "index_contents.css";body{background:#E8E8E8 url(../img/index/bg.gif) repeat-x center top;color: #ddd;}/* LAYOUT------------------------------------------*/#wrapper{margin:0 auto;width:800px;border-right:#9E9E9E 1px solid;border-left:#9E9E9E 1px solid;min-height:100%;background:#000;text-align:left;}/* Hides from IE-mac \*/* html #wrapper{height:100%;}/* End hide from IE-mac */#header{height:356px;padding:0 0 0 30px;background:#fff;}#gNav{background:#000 url(../img/index/contents_bg.gif) repeat-x;margin:0;height:40px;padding:0 0 7px 0;width:800px;position:relative;}#contents{}/* CLEAR FIX [BEGIN] */#contents:after {    content: ".";     display: block;     height: 0;     clear: both;     visibility: hidden;}#contents {    display: inline-table;    min-height: 1%;}/* Hides from IE-mac \*/* html #contents {height: 1%;}#contents {display: block;}/* End hide from IE-mac *//* CLEAR FIX [END] */#footer{clear:both;padding:25px 15px 30px 24px;font-size:84%;}/* CLEAR FIX [BEGIN] */#footer:after {    content: ".";     display: block;     height: 0;     clear: both;     visibility: hidden;}#footer {    display: inline-table;    min-height: 1%;}/* Hides from IE-mac \*/* html #footer {height: 1%;}#footer {display: block;}/* End hide from IE-mac *//* CLEAR FIX [END] *//*STYLE----------------------------------------*/#header h1{padding-top:75px;line-height:0px;}#header #visual{margin:-125px 0 0 290px;}#header h2{margin:-151px 0 0 0;}#header object{margin-left:-30px;}#gNav li{width:160px;position:absolute;margin:0;list-style:none;padding:0;line-height:0px;}#gNav li#nav1{left:0px;}#gNav li#nav2{left:160px;}#gNav li#nav3{left:320px;}#gNav li#nav4{left:480px;}#gNav li#nav5{left:640px;}#footer ul{margin:0;width:375px;float:left;}#footer ul li{list-style:none;display:inline;border-left:#8B8B8B 1px solid;margin-right:1.2em;padding-left:1.2em;text-transform:uppercase;}#footer ul li.firstChild,#footer ul li:first-child{border-left:0;padding-left:0;}#footer a{ color:#ddd; text-decoration:none}#footer a:hover,#footer a:active{ text-decoration:underline;}#footer p#copy{width:385px;color:#aaa;float:right;text-align:right;line-height:1.3;margin:0;text-transform:uppercase;letter-spacing:0.1em;}.uppercase{text-transform:uppercase;letter-spacing:0.1em;}
